| A serum chemistry profile is a blood test that will measure several important electrolytes, enzymes, and metabolites.This test can be used as a screening tool to detect abnormalities before symptoms arise or as a tool to help diagnose different internal problems.
A chemistry profile may be recommended if your pet shows signs of dehydration, vomiting or diarrhea of unknown cause, increase or decrease in appetite or thirst, significant weight loss or gain, lethargy or many other signs of illness. Potential dysfunction of the liver or kidneys is often diagnosed from this test.
A superchemistry provides the same information as a serum chemistry profile, with the addition of several other enzymes and electrolytes which your doctor may have suspicion to be causing your pet's problems.
The results of the chemistry will be interpreted along with physical examination findings and other laboratory tests to diagnose and best treat your pet's conditions.
